SAN DIEGO — In a matter of days, Californians will be permitted to jaywalk, within reason, without running the … Witryna28 gru 2024 · Freedom to jaywalk. Crossing a street off a sidewalk is technically illegal in California, but as of Jan. 1, police are required to look the other way. The Freedom to Walk Act states that unruly pedestrians should not be ticketed unless they create an “imminent risk of a collision.”

Witryna13 sty 2024 · Jaywalking is dangerous and illegal because it can catch drivers off guard and interfere with the flow of traffic. Jaywalking is … Witrynajay·walk. (jā′wôk′) intr.v. jay·walked, jay·walk·ing, jay·walks. To walk across a street in violation of traffic law, especially by crossing outside of a marked pedestrian crosswalk at an intersection. [From jay, inexperienced person .]
